What is a Private Mental Health Assessment?
A private mental health assessment is a thorough evaluation performed by a certified mental health expert. This assessment aims to comprehend an individual's mental, emotional, and behavioral functioning. It can address different issues, from anxiety and depression to more extreme mental health disorders.
Secret Objectives of a Private Mental Health Assessment
| Goal | Description |
|---|---|
| Diagnosis | To determine any mental health conditions present. |
| Treatment Planning | To recommend treatment choices based upon the individual's specific requirements and circumstances. |
| Personal Insight | To offer the private with a much deeper understanding of their mental health status and challenges. |
| Keeping track of Progress | To develop a baseline for keeping track of enhancements over time. |
| Bespoke Recommendations | To tailor tips for therapy, medication, or other interventions. |
The Assessment Process
The private mental health assessment procedure typically includes numerous stages focused on gathering extensive info about the person's mental health history and current state. Here's a breakdown of the common parts involved:
1. Initial Consultation
- Period: Usually lasts 30 to 60 minutes.
- Focus: Discussion of the individual's concerns, objectives for the assessment, and any pertinent history.
2. Standardized Questionnaires
- Function: To assess various psychological signs.
- Typical Tools Used:
- Beck Depression Inventory
- Generalized Anxiety Disorder 7 (GAD-7)
- Patient Health Questionnaire (PHQ-9)
3. Clinical Interview
- Period: Can take 1 to 2 hours.
- Focus: A structured or semi-structured interview exploring the person's history, signs, and functioning.
4. Feedback Session
- Purpose: To go over findings, identify if suitable, and summary possible treatment options.
- Outcome: A personalized report summing up assessments' results along with recommendations.
Benefits of a Private Mental Health Assessment
Private mental health assessments use many benefits that can considerably affect a person's mental well-being and quality of life.
Boosted Confidentiality
Among the main advantages of private assessments is the high level of confidentiality they supply. Private practitioners are bound by rigorous ethical standards that focus on client privacy.
Personalized Care
Private mental health assessments frequently yield more tailored treatment plans, tailored to the individual's special circumstances. This uniqueness can lead to more effective intervention strategies.
Decreased Wait Times
In a private setting, people usually experience much shorter waiting durations compared to public mental health services. This timely access can be crucial for those seeking immediate assistance.
Access to Specialized Services
Private assessments may offer access to experts who have specific competence in dealing with particular mental health conditions. This can be especially beneficial for individuals requiring specialized care.
Cost Considerations
While private mental health assessments have clear advantages, it is important to think about the cost. The expenditures associated with these services can vary considerably based upon elements such as area, clinician experience, and the level of the assessment. Below is a streamlined cost table for referral.
| Kind of Assessment | Estimated Cost Range |
|---|---|
| Preliminary Consultation | ₤ 100 - ₤ 250 |
| Full Assessment | ₤ 200 - ₤ 600 |
| Follow-up Sessions | ₤ 100 - ₤ 300 |
| Specialized Testing (if required) | ₤ 150 - ₤ 500 |
Payment Options
Many private professionals offer a variety of payment alternatives. Some may accept insurance, while others offer versatile payment strategies to reduce financial strain.
When to Consider a Private Mental Health Assessment
Deciding whether to seek a private mental health assessment depends on different elements. Here's a list to help assess the requirement of evaluation:
Signs You Might Need an Assessment
- Relentless sensations of unhappiness or despondence.
- Increasing stress and anxiety or anxiety attack.
- Considerable modifications in state of mind or habits.
- Trouble working in every day life or work.
- Drug abuse problems.
- Chronic stress resulting from life modifications or transitions.
- Relationship problems affecting personal well-being.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How do I find a private mental health assessor?
Start by looking into qualified mental health professionals in your location. Expert associations, recommendations from healthcare providers, and online directories can be invaluable resources.
2. Will my insurance cover a private mental health assessment?
It depends on your particular insurance coverage plan. Some plans might cover a portion of the expenses associated with private assessments. It's best to check with your provider for specifics.
3. How long does the assessment process take?
The period can differ, however many assessments are completed within a few hours, generally spread across one or two sessions.
4. What happens after the assessment?
You will get feedback concerning your assessment results, consisting of a suggested treatment plan if required. It is important to preserve ongoing communication with your mental health professional moving on.
5. Exists a difference between private and public assessments?
Yes, public assessments may have longer waiting times and typically follow standardized standards more rigidly. Private assessments typically offer more extensive evaluations with increased privacy and customized care.
